Basically, [specifically NEWBS] DON'T POST QUESTIONS HERE, simply post the following and update as you wish. Point is to dictate what went bad & when using this thread for future reference and as a general idea, as to avoid stupid threads asking when peoples' trans. gave out [as an example]
Copy this format below;
I'll start.
Year: 2001
Mileage: 138k MILES [US AMERICAN CAR]
Location: Canada [regular winter/summer conditions/exposed to elements]
Regular maintenance: Followed
Bad: Struts, sway bushings front&back, AC compressor, Right Rear caliper, at 100k Right front caliper
140k-ish, new valve covers, spark plugs, belts
145k, new [used] trans
147k, rear driver caliper & rear brakes
155k, new OCV's both just in case
I'm sure I'm missing some stuff, but it would bring me into a great depression looking over what I spent on this thing.

2001 Lexus ES 300
Bought in Ottawa from Bel Air Lexus certified dealer.
57,000 km when purchused 1 owner.
Location: Canada, GTA, winter, rust, humidity, blah blah blah...no good conditions!
Currently 195,000 km.
150,000 km did timing belt/water pump.
around 120,000 km some sensor in the exhaust failed (60 $ part, easy to replace).
190,000 did front struts, bushings, steering linkages.
Rear bushings or something else was done around 140,000 km, but forgot what exactly (lol yes I'm special)
195,000 replaced PCV valve and fuel filter (nothing went wrong, just wanted to do it and get new ones as I was still running originals).
195,000 both rear back plates behind rotor are rusted down to nothing and need to be replaced.
Around 120,000 did new coolant, tranny fluid (with filter and gasket, again just wanted it replaced).
Around 170,000 replaced all 4 original rotors with powerslot ones, new brake pads, did brake fluid flush.
Still running original Xenon bulbs lol.
I need new rims because the 16 inchers that came with the car are shot, will get new rims when these tires are done.
Car was also run on full synthetic oil since purchuse, and for the last 1.5 years on Amsoil XL.

2001
189K miles
Buffalo NY=sucky weather
86k-Rear Sway bar bushings ($100)
110k- 90k mile service done at dealer ($1700)
110k- Bad o2 Sensor ($150)
135k-Replace original front calipers and rotors ($300)
146k-Replace struts all round (rears are now gone and need to be replaced again) ($500)
156k- Trunk and driver door lock cylinder needed to be cleaned (Free)
176k-New charcoal canister ($600)
182k- Knock Sensor Replace($550)
184k-Replace front sway bar links($60)
184k-Oil Control Valves Replaced($600 for both i think)
184k- Drain and fill transmission fluid($46)
184k- Replace original calipers and Rotors on rear ($500)
Thats all i can think of off the top of my head, have owned the car since new. other then this new tires every 40k miles, rotations every 5k miles, oil changes every 5k miles, coolant/transmission every 60k and washed every 2 days. I need new strut mounts and struts in the back, and will replace rear sway bar links at the same time
Rough estimates on how much i paid, little over 5 grand but it is very close. Probably other stuff i am forgetting
